Intel to Benefit From AI Component Supply Crunch, CEO Says -- Market Talk
Dow Jones2026/07/23 22:25Intel should be a beneficiary of the supply crunch in components used to power artificial-intelligence infrastructure, CEO Lip-Bu Tan tells analysts on a Thursday call. The industry "is facing one of the most severe supply constraints in its history across leading edge logic, silicon wafers, memory, and subscripts. These shortages will persist for the foreseeable future," he says. "Intel is well positioned to benefit from this strong sustained demand." Intel plans to ramp its investments to support what looks to be an improving demand outlook, Tan says. Intel shares are up 1.7%, paring back gains from an after-hours rally after the company posted second-quarter results well above Wall Street expectations. (elias.schisgall@wsj.com)
